What are the most common Subaru repair issues for drivers in Kenilworth, NJ?

Due to our local climate with cold winters and road salt, common issues include premature rust on brake lines and suspension components, as well as head gasket leaks on older models (like the 2.5L engines in pre-2012 Foresters and Outbacks). CVT transmission fluid service is also critical for newer models facing stop-and-go traffic on routes like Route 22.

When should I seek service for my Subaru's All-Wheel Drive system in this area?

You should have the AWD system inspected if you notice unusual vibrations, binding when turning, or a dashboard warning light. Given Kenilworth's seasonal weather, it's wise to get a pre-winter check to ensure the differentials and transfer case are functioning properly for safe traction on snow and ice.

Are Subaru repair costs in Kenilworth generally higher than for other brands?

Subaru repair costs can be slightly higher due to the specialized nature of the boxer engine and AWD system. However, independent shops in the Kenilworth area typically off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ships, especially for common maintenance and repairs, helping to manage overall costs.

What local driving conditions in Kenilworth should influence my Subaru's maintenance schedule?

The combination of winter potholes, summer heat, and frequent short trips on local roads means you should adhere strictly to severe service schedules. This includes more frequent oil changes, tire rotations to combat uneven wear, and diligent checks of suspension and steering components for damage from rough roads.
